松辽坳陷盆地水侵期湖底扇沉积特征及地球物理响应

摘要
综合利用井筒资料、分析化验资料、岩心资料和薄片鉴定资料,研究了松辽盆地英台他拉哈地区青一、二段湖底扇的沉积特征。结果表明,湖底扇由英台扇三角洲前缘相带的砂体整体滑塌并近距离搬运所形成,形成过程具多期次性。湖底扇具有敏感的地震响应。充分利用三维地震资料,通过井震精细标定、地震动力学参数提取、等时切片、储层反演等综合手段,精细刻划了砂体的空间分布特征。综合分析认为,湖底扇在平面上叠加连片,空间上呈透镜体展布;湖底扇具有较大油气勘探潜力,勘探目标以岩性油藏为主。
The sublacustrine fan deposits were discovered in the K2qn1 and K2qn2 of Yingtai-Talaha area of Songliao Basin by using the integrated methodology of geology and geophysics.The data of well bore,testing,core and thin section showed that the sublacustrine fan deposits were resulted from the entire slump and short-distance transportation of sand bodies in the fan delta front of Yingtai area.The sublacustrine fan was characterized by the sensible seismic response.The 3D seismic data from Yingtai-Talaha area were applied to determine the geophysical response characteristics of the sublacustrine fan,to describe the distribution of sand bodies and to define the boundary and distribution range of the sublacustrine fan by the fine calibration of logs and seismic reflection event,and the extraction of seismic dynamic parameters,horizontal section and reservoir inversion.The integrative analyses showed that reservoir sand bodies of the sublacustrine fan stacked in plane and stretched in the shape of a lens in space.It indicates that the sublacustrine fan has beneficial exploration potentiality,and the lithologic reservoirs are the main exploration targets.
